How did Chelsea win the Champions League 2021?

Chelsea has won its second Champions League title, delivered by a Kai Havertz goal in a thrilling, taut final marred by a head injury that forced City’s playmaker, Kevin De Bruyne, from the game in the second half. Chelsea’s title is its second in the competition.

What is Chelsea’s biggest defeat?

Record defeat: 1–8 v. Wolverhampton Wanderers, First Division, 26 September 1953. Record Premier League defeat: 0–6 v. Manchester City, 10 February 2019. Record FA Cup defeat: 0–6 v. Sheffield Wednesday, Second Round Replay, 5 February 1913.

When did Chelsea win the Champions League?

The season culminated in the club’s second European Cup victory, as on 29 May 2021, Chelsea defeated fellow English side Manchester City in the Champions League final to be crowned champions of Europe.

How many seasons has Chelsea been in the Premier League?

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ia The 2020–21 season was Chelsea ‘s 107th competitive season, 32nd consecutive season in the top flight of English football, 29th consecutive season in the Premier League, and 115th year in existence as a football club. The season covered the period from 1 July 2020 to 30 June 2021.
